>Simple question. I have a form where the user needs not use any more than
>one line in each text feild. Therefore I would like to submit the form if
>the user hits the enter or return key, else they will hit the post button..


You might be able to do it by trapping the keydown and only passing
the key if it's not a Return or an Enter, but another way to do it is
to watch the number of lines there are in the field. If it is more
than one, then post line 1.
